Overview of the Rivian R2
Rivian Automotive, known for its innovative electric trucks and SUVs, is expanding its lineup with the R2, designed to be a more compact and affordable vehicle compared to the R1 series. Slated for production in 2024, the R2 is expected to be priced competitively, appealing not only to current Rivian fans but also to a broader audience looking for sustainable transportation solutions.
Key Features and Specifications
The Rivian R2 is set to include several cutting-edge features, such as:
- Range: Expected to offer a range of around 250 miles on a single charge, suitable for daily commutes and weekend adventures.
- Performance: The R2 will likely feature dual-motor all-wheel drive, delivering robust performance and off-road capabilities inherent to the Rivian brand.
- Innovative Technology: Advanced driver-assistance systems and an expansive infotainment interface will provide drivers with a high-tech driving experience.
- Eco-friendliness: Like its predecessors, the R2 will utilize sustainable materials and manufacturing practices, aligning with Rivian’s commitment to environmental responsibility.
Market Context and Competition
The launch of the R2 comes amidst increasing competition in the electric vehicle market. Rivian will be competing against established giants like Tesla, Ford with its Mustang Mach-E, and newcomers like Lucid Motors. Consumer interest in electric vehicles has surged, and the R2 aims to capture at least a share of this rapidly growing market. Factors such as safety ratings, range, pricing, and customer service will play vital roles in its success.
